    One thing that you might have missed or glossed over is that Returning to the Past has one limit: It can't bring back the dead. To be fair they only say it twice in season one. They mention this vaguely in the first episode where Odd says "And even going back in time, if there’s an accident, it’s all over" and in the season 1 finale (Episode 26) Ulrich makes it more clear by saying "You know very well that if there's a victim, that going back in time won't bring him back to life"

    Ghost Channel is always going to be one of my favorite episodes, just because it's a clever subversion of the "how do we tell someone from their evil twin!?" trope, where the evil twin is identified by rigid adherence to character archetype, and the real character is identified by malleability and adaptiveness, who will do something seemingly "against character" if the circumstances are dire enough to merit it. I've seen almost no other show explore this idea: it seems like writers, when presented the opportunity to use this trope, are obsessed with showing off the idea of "look how well these characters know each other, that they can tell when someone is acting weird [by doing something uncharacteristic of them!]", and Code Lyoko flipped the idea on its head, emphasizing the idea that if these characters are real people (or at least as much as they can be while still being fictional characters), then it makes way more sense that unusual circumstances would lead to unusual behavior-something that a rigid AI like XANA would struggle to understand.

    Most of the locations in Code Lyoko are based on real places. You mentioned the factory, but Kadic Academy is also based on Lycée Lakanal, which Thomas Romain attended when he was a kid.
